The opportunityUnity empowers millions of creators worldwide to build groundbreaking real-time games, apps, and experiences across countless genres, platforms, and devices. As our technology stack has grown more powerful and complex, the need for real-world validation of innovations prior to broad release has become critical. The Production Verification (PV) Program embeds our Unity Studio Productions (USP) team directly into strategic partner game productions and ensures that every major advancement, optimization, or feature we build is proven in production, before it reaches our broader Unity ecosystem.We are seeking a driven and experienced Technical Program/Project Manager (TPM) to join our growing team. As a PV TPM, you will play a pivotal role in leading and managing Production Verification for complex technical projects from inception to completion. You will leverage your technical expertise, program and project management skills to ensure PV projects are delivered in a timely fashion and enable stakeholders to gain clarity on how well their Product increment meets Production needs.
